Montevideo is the capital and largest city of Uruguay.[1]
History[edit | edit source]
By the early 18th century, Montevideo was the largest city and chief naval base in the region, with traders and merchants coming from all over the Americas to do business there. The Welsh pirate Edward Kenway shipped wine[2] and tobacco to the city, making a tidy profit with each trade.[3]
